Economic forces shape our lives and the lives of those around us. They affect the choices we make as individuals and as a society. Economics helps you to understand our society at a local, national and global level. It is an academic A Level highly valued by universities, but also a subject that deals with vital matters concerning all our daily lives. For many students, an in-depth knowledge of Economics is the foundation for successful high profile careers in politics, finance and international business. Economics is also useful to those who wish to go on to study any of the Social Science subjects including Politics, International Relations, Government, Sociology, Marketing, History, Business and Management. As a Social Science, A Level Economics blends well with all subjects.
